    Julianne Hough and Brooks Laich have agreed the terms of their divorce, almost two years after they split

    The 33-year-old former 'Dancing with the Stars' professional and judge filed for divorce from the 38-year-old ex-ice hockey star in November 2020, six months after they confirmed they had decided to go their separate ways


    And now, Us Weekly reports that the exes' divorce is close to being finalised as they await approval from the judge.

    The papers filed on Tuesday (22.02.22) read: "The parties have entered into a written agreement regarding their property and their marriage or domestic partnership rights, including support, the original of which is being or has been submitted to the court."

    According to the news outlet, Julianne has given up her right to receive spousal support from Brooks.

    The pair announced their separation in a joint statement after they had spent months self-isolating separately amid the coronavirus pandemic, with Brooks in Idaho and Julianne at home in Los Angeles.

    Their statement read: "We have lovingly and carefully taken the time we have needed to arrive at our decision to separate. We share an abundance of love and respect for one another and will continue to lead with our hearts from that place. We kindly request your compassion and respect for our privacy moving forward."

    Sources had claimed that although they tried to work on their marriage, they ultimately felt as though they had too many "problems" to make a romance work between them.

    One insider said: "Julianne and Brooks just can't get past their problems. Julianne had a dinner party with friends a few months ago, which Brooks came to. They were trying to be lovey-dovey with each other and have a good night with a few friends, but Brooks ended up bringing up some of their issues in front of everyone and it became a big fight."

    The former couple remained close after splitting in May 2020, because of their mutual friends and shared business deals, but decided they're better off as friends.

    The source added: "When they took time apart, Julianne was heavily involved with Kinrgy, and because Brooks helped her develop it, they continued to stay in touch and also were connected because they share the same friend group. They missed each other and ended up hooking up a few times during their breakup and have tried to sort out their marriage and business commitments."

    The pair tied the knot in 2017.
